What a PayPal invoice template for procurement is and when to use it

A PayPal invoice template for procurement is a standardized invoice layout configured to collect payments through PayPal while recording procurement-specific details such as purchase order numbers, vendor codes, line-item receipts, and approval references. Organizations use these templates to streamline purchase transactions, reduce manual entry, and centralize billing metadata for procurement audits. When paired with an eSignature and document workflow platform, templates preserve consistent formatting, speed approvals, and attach immutable records to each invoice for later reconciliation and compliance checks across accounts payable and procurement teams.

Common procurement invoice challenges addressed by templates

  • Inconsistent invoice fields across vendors cause delayed matching with purchase orders and extra manual reconciliation work for AP teams.
  • Manually adding payment links increases human error and creates security risk when sensitive payment instructions are shared in unsecured email.
  • Lack of an audit trail makes it difficult to show signer intent and approval timing during procurement audits or dispute resolution.
  • Templates that don't include procurement metadata limit automated matching to internal systems and prolong invoice-to-payment cycles.

Key features that improve procurement invoice templates

A robust template and eSignature tool adds features that reduce errors, enforce policy, and maintain records required by procurement and finance.

Template Fields

Custom fields for purchase order numbers, department codes, and contract references enforce consistent metadata capture and reduce exceptions during AP matching and procurement reporting procedures.

Payment Links

Built-in PayPal or payment gateway links let suppliers pay directly and securely from the invoice while preserving a clear payment record in the invoice metadata and audit trail.

Approval Workflows

Configurable multi-step approvals and conditional routing ensure invoices pass required procurement or finance reviews before payment, with each step recorded in the audit log.

Bulk Send

Bulk Send capability distributes the same invoice template to many recipients and captures individual responses, reducing repetitive tasks for recurring vendor invoices and mass billing events.

Audit Trail

Immutable logs capture signer identity, timestamps, and IP addresses to demonstrate signer intent and support compliance during internal or external procurement audits.

API Access

APIs enable automated invoice generation and data exchange with procurement systems so templates can be populated from ERP or P2P workflows without manual intervention.

Best practices for secure, accurate procurement invoice templates

Follow these best practices to reduce errors, ensure compliance, and speed payment cycles when using PayPal invoice templates in procurement.

Standardize required procurement fields on templates
Include mandatory fields for purchase order number, cost center, approver ID, and vendor tax information so invoices align with procurement and accounting requirements and reduce exceptions during automated matching.
Enable role-based approvals and signer authentication
Use role-based routing and strong authentication to ensure only authorized procurement staff approve invoices, and require multi-factor authentication for high-value transactions to reduce fraud risk.
Preserve complete audit trails for each transaction
Capture signer details, timestamps, IP addresses, and document versions to support compliance, internal audits, and dispute resolution while retaining immutable records per your retention policy.
Validate payment links and test integration regularly
Regularly test PayPal links and any integration used to collect payment to ensure funds correctly map to invoices, that payment confirmations are captured, and that vendor workflows remain uninterrupted.
